Ingredients
You don’t need fancy stuff—just these basics! Here’s what you’ll need:
- 2 cups shredded cooked chicken
- 4 cups chicken broth
- 1 packet ranch seasoning mix
- 8 ounces cream cheese
- 1 cup corn (frozen or canned)
- 1 cup cheddar cheese, shredded
- 1/2 cup green onions, chopped
- Salt and pepper to taste
Directions
Time to get cooking! Follow these simple steps:
- In a large pot, combine shredded chicken, chicken broth, and ranch seasoning. Bring to a boil.
- Add cream cheese and stir until melted and well combined.
- Mix in corn and cheddar cheese, cooking until heated through.
- Season with salt and pepper to taste.
- Serve warm, garnished with chopped green onions.

How to Store Crack Chicken Soup
Got leftovers? Good news! Crack Chicken Soup keeps well in the fridge for about 3-4 days. If you want to freeze it, pop individual portions in an airtight container for up to 3 months. When reheating, add a splash of chicken broth if it thickens too much; you want it creamy, not concrete!
Tips to Make Crack Chicken Soup
Want to take your soup to the next level? Here are some insider tricks:
- Use rotisserie chicken for a quick shortcut—hello, flavor!
- If you love a little heat, toss in some diced jalapeños or hot sauce.
- For a lighter version, swap cream cheese for Greek yogurt.
- Want to supercharge the veggies? Add some diced bell peppers or carrots for extra crunch!

FAQs
How can I make this soup ahead of time?
Absolutely! Make it one day ahead and store it in the fridge. This soup tastes even better the next day as the flavors develop.
Can I freeze Crack Chicken Soup?
Yes! Just cool it completely and freeze in portions. Thaw in the fridge overnight before reheating.
What can I substitute for chicken?
You can use canned tuna or even tofu for a different twist!
